Problem Description This is your last assignment and it is also your capstone project. You need to use what you learned from chapters 1 to 11 to create this project. The results of a survey of the households in your township have been made available. Each record contains data for one household, including a four-digit integer identification number, the annual income for the household, and the number of members of the household. You may assume no more than 25 households were surveyed. Define a structure type named household_t to store the record for one family You need to write two separate program files. The description of each program file is as follow: Program 1 You need to write a program to create a binary data file of the household data. Data should be requested from the keyboard and written to the data file. Identification Number 1041 1062 1327 1483 1900 2112 2345 3210 3600 3601 4725 6217 9280 Annual Income $12,180 13,240 19,800 24,458 17,000 19,125 17,623 5,200 9,500 11,970 9,800 10,000 8,200 Household Members 4 3 2 8 2 7 2 6 5 2 3 2 1 Problem Description This is your last assignment and it is also your capstone project.
